主要研究方向:

主要围绕食源性危害因子新型生物识别分子设计筛选;新型生物纳米传感检测方法构建;粮食食品中危害因子高效降解脱毒技术以及食品危害物因子风险评估与毒理学评价研究等方面开展研究。
